本發(fā)明涉及智能水杯領(lǐng)域,尤其涉及一種智能對話水杯的碰杯方法及系統(tǒng)。
背景技術(shù):
隨著社會與科技的發(fā)展,人工智能化成為發(fā)展趨勢,尤其是每天和我們息息相關(guān)的產(chǎn)品更是提前進入互聯(lián)網(wǎng)的大軍。水杯由原來盛裝液體的容器,演變成智能化,如顯示水杯內(nèi)的水量,溫度等信息,同時也可以定時提醒飲水者飲水。但是現(xiàn)有智能水杯功能單一,無法滿足廣大用戶的需求。
技術(shù)實現(xiàn)要素:
為了解決上述技術(shù)問題,本發(fā)明的目的是提供一種能夠?qū)崿F(xiàn)碰杯趣味對話的智能對話水杯的碰杯方法及系統(tǒng)。
本發(fā)明所采用的技術(shù)方案是:一種智能對話水杯的碰杯方法,其包括:當水杯在碰杯過后,水杯檢測到碰杯的動作,進入通信狀態(tài);水杯對外發(fā)送語音播放請求命令,在收到回復后開始按照之前己方發(fā)送命令的參數(shù)播放對話;
水杯收到播放請求命令,先發(fā)送針對這個命令的回復,然后延遲預設(shè)時間后播放對應(yīng)的對話。
進一步,所述水杯通過語音錄制進行對話設(shè)置。
進一步,所述水杯的數(shù)據(jù)接收與數(shù)據(jù)發(fā)送為分時進行的,所述水杯的數(shù)據(jù)接收與發(fā)送的狀態(tài)隨機切換。
進一步,所述水杯的數(shù)據(jù)接收與發(fā)送的時間片的時長隨機切換。
進一步,水杯在無任何操作的情況下進入休眠狀態(tài)。
另外本發(fā)明還提供了一種智能對話水杯的碰杯系統(tǒng),其包括不少于2個水杯,所述水杯包括:
動作檢測單元:用于水杯檢測碰杯動作,水杯檢測到碰杯的動作后,進入通信狀態(tài);
發(fā)送單元:用于水杯對外發(fā)送語音播放請求命令,在收到回復后開始按照之前己方發(fā)送命令的參數(shù)播放對話;
接收單元:用于水杯收到播放請求命令,先發(fā)送針對這個命令的回復,然后延遲預設(shè)時間后播放對應(yīng)的對話。
進一步,所述水杯還包括:對話錄制單元,所述對話錄制單元用于水杯通過語音錄制進行對話設(shè)置。
進一步,所述水杯還包括:第一通信狀態(tài)切換單元,所述第一通信狀態(tài)切換單元用于隨機切換水杯的數(shù)據(jù)接收與發(fā)送的狀態(tài)。
進一步,所述水杯還包括:第二通信狀態(tài)切換單元,所述第二通信狀態(tài)切換單元用于隨機切換水杯的數(shù)據(jù)接收與發(fā)送的時間片的時長。
進一步,所述水杯還包括:休眠單元,所述休眠單元用于水杯在無任何操作的情況下進入休眠狀態(tài)。
本發(fā)明的有益效果是:本發(fā)明通過在水杯碰杯時建立通信機制, 實現(xiàn)趣味對話,大大加強了水杯娛樂性,提高了了用戶的使用體驗及樂趣。
附圖說明
下面結(jié)合附圖對本發(fā)明的具體實施方式作進一步說明:
圖1是本發(fā)明一種智能對話水杯的碰杯方法一具體實施例的流程圖;
圖2是本發(fā)明一種智能對話水杯的碰杯方法一具體實施例的狀態(tài)圖
圖3是本發(fā)明一種智能對話水杯的碰杯方法一具體實施例中通信收發(fā)時間片的示意圖。
具體實施方式
需要說明的是,在不沖突的情況下,本申請中的實施例及實施例中的特征可以相互組合。
實施例1
如圖1所示,一種智能對話水杯的碰杯方法,其包括:當水杯在碰杯過后,水杯檢測到碰杯的動作,進入通信狀態(tài);水杯對外發(fā)送語音播放請求命令,在收到回復后開始按照之前己方發(fā)送命令的參數(shù)播放對話;水杯收到播放請求命令,先發(fā)送針對這個命令的回復,然后延遲預設(shè)時間后播放對應(yīng)的對話。在水杯碰杯時建立通信機制,碰杯時水杯間進行數(shù)據(jù)交互,實現(xiàn)碰杯趣味語音對話,大大加強了水杯娛樂性,提高了了用戶的使用體驗及樂趣。
實施例2
檢測到碰杯的動作,水杯從休眠態(tài)喚醒,進入通信狀態(tài),在通信狀態(tài)下進行語音對話協(xié)商,水杯發(fā)送對話邀請,收到對方邀請的回復包之后結(jié)束通信。所述語音對話協(xié)商包括播放哪段對話,雙方在對話中的角色定義等。
在碰杯過后,杯蓋會對外發(fā)送語音播放請求命令(請求命令的參數(shù)決定了播放水杯預置語音組中的哪一組),同時會偵聽通信信號,水杯收到播放請求命令(根據(jù)命令參數(shù)知道自己需要播放那條對話),發(fā)送針對這個命令的回復。杯蓋收到播放命令的回復,開始按照之前己方發(fā)送命令的參數(shù)播放對話,此時這個杯蓋充當對話發(fā)起方的角色。另外一方延遲一段時間后播放對應(yīng)的對話,這個杯蓋作為對話應(yīng)答方。完成一次對話,需要進入通信狀態(tài)告知對方完成一組對話,通信告知對方,所以對話完成。所述的對話內(nèi)容,可通過語音錄制等進行設(shè)置。
實施例3
本發(fā)明可采用sub 1G,2.4g,wifi,藍牙等無線通信方式進行通信,實現(xiàn)數(shù)據(jù)交互。
作為優(yōu)選的實施方式本發(fā)明采用聲波進行通信,在通信速度要求不高的場合替代傳統(tǒng)的無線通信(sub 1G,2.4g,wifi,藍牙等),尤其是需要播音的設(shè)備上在不增加硬件投入時,采用聲波通信可節(jié)省生產(chǎn)成本。
聲波數(shù)據(jù)數(shù)據(jù)的收和發(fā)是分時進行的,在一個時間點,一個設(shè)備只能是在接收或者發(fā)送的狀態(tài),但是在第一次通信成功之前,通信的雙方并不知道自己應(yīng)該是在什么狀態(tài)才能成功與對方通信,下面的這種 機制的加入解決了該問題,如圖3所示,A,B兩臺設(shè)備都處在通信狀態(tài),都有數(shù)據(jù)需要發(fā)送,黑色代表設(shè)備在發(fā)送狀態(tài),白色代表在接收狀態(tài),黑白上下交叉的地方(一個設(shè)備在發(fā)送數(shù)據(jù),另一臺設(shè)備在數(shù)據(jù)監(jiān)聽狀態(tài))數(shù)據(jù)就可以正常收發(fā).
每個時間片設(shè)備的通信狀態(tài),以及每個時間片的時常都是通過隨機數(shù)的形式確定的,這樣每個設(shè)備里面2組獨立的隨機時間片和狀態(tài)的快速切換,可以保證即使發(fā)生通信碰撞,也很容易在下一個時刻跳開,從而完成各自的數(shù)據(jù)的收發(fā)任務(wù)。
實施例4
如圖2所示,水杯在3種狀態(tài)下任意切換,其包括休眠狀態(tài)、通信狀態(tài)和語音播放狀態(tài),水杯沒有任何操作的狀態(tài)處于休眠狀態(tài),當水杯碰杯時進入通信狀態(tài),在通信狀態(tài)下經(jīng)語音對話協(xié)商后進入語音播放狀態(tài)。完成一次對話,需要進入通信狀態(tài)告知對方完成一組對話,通信告知對方,進入休眠狀態(tài),對話協(xié)商沒有完成,進入休眠狀態(tài)。等待下次碰杯激活。在休眠狀態(tài)中,對設(shè)備的任何操作(除開機按鈕以外)均屬于無效的操作,只有當處于待機狀態(tài)后才可開始操作。休眠狀態(tài)能夠在很大程度上省電。
另外本發(fā)明還提供了一種智能對話水杯的碰杯系統(tǒng),其包括不少于2個水杯,所述水杯通過聲波通信連接,實現(xiàn)數(shù)據(jù)交互,所述水杯包括:
動作檢測單元:用于水杯檢測碰杯動作,水杯檢測到碰杯的動作后,進入通信狀態(tài);
發(fā)送單元:用于水杯對外發(fā)送語音播放請求命令,在收到回復后開始按照之前己方發(fā)送命令的參數(shù)播放對話;
接收單元:用于水杯收到播放請求命令,先發(fā)送針對這個命令的回復,然后延遲預設(shè)時間后播放對應(yīng)的對話。
進一步作為優(yōu)選的實施方式,所述水杯還包括:對話錄制單元,所述對話錄制單元用于水杯通過語音錄制進行對話設(shè)置。
進一步作為優(yōu)選的實施方式,所述水杯還包括:第一通信狀態(tài)切換單元,所述第一通信狀態(tài)切換單元用于隨機切換水杯的數(shù)據(jù)接收與發(fā)送的狀態(tài)。
進一步作為優(yōu)選的實施方式,所述水杯還包括:第二通信狀態(tài)切換單元,所述第二通信狀態(tài)切換單元用于隨機切換水杯的數(shù)據(jù)接收與發(fā)送的時間片的時長。
進一步作為優(yōu)選的實施方式,所述水杯還包括:休眠單元,所述休眠單元用于水杯在無任何操作的情況下進入休眠狀態(tài)。
本發(fā)明通過在水杯碰杯時建立通信機制,實現(xiàn)趣味對話,大大加強了水杯娛樂性,提高了了用戶的使用體驗及樂趣。
以上是對本發(fā)明的較佳實施進行了具體說明,但本發(fā)明創(chuàng)造并不限于所述實施例,熟悉本領(lǐng)域的技術(shù)人員在不違背本發(fā)明精神的前提下還可做作出種種的等同變形或替換,這些等同的變形或替換均包含在本申請權(quán)利要求所限定的范圍內(nèi)。